German Chocolate Cake recipe 

Ingredients: (pan size 6-inch, two pan)

1 cups (120g) all-purpose flour

1  cups (200g) granulated sugar

1/4 cup (35g) unsweetened cocoa powder

 1/2 tsp baking powder

1/4 tsp baking soda

1/4tsp salt

2 large eggs

1/2 cup (120ml) buttermilk

1/4 cup (60ml) vegetable oil

1 tsp pure vanilla extract

3tbsp warm water(45ml)


For the coconut pecan filling :-

1/2cup (100g) granulated sugar

1/2cup (120ml) evaporated milk

1/4 cup (57g) unsalted butter

2 large egg yolks

1 tsp pure vanilla extract

1 cups (71g) sweetened shredded coconut

1/2cup (60g) chopped pecans


Instructions:

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ease and flour two 6-inch  round cake pans.

In a large mixing bowl, sift together the flour, cocoa powder, sugar, baking powder, baking soda, and salt.

Add the eggs, buttermilk, vegetable oil, and vanilla extract to the dry ingredients. Mix until well combined.

Divide the batter evenly between the two prepared cake pans.

Bake in the preheated (175℃) oven for about 20-25 minutes or until a toothpick inserted into the center of the cakes comes out clean.

While the cakes are baking, prepare the coconut pecan filling .
In a saucepan, combine the sugar, evaporated milk, butter, and egg yolks.
Cook over medium heat, stirring constantly until the mixture thickens, which should take about 8-10 minutes 

Remove from heat, and stir in the vanilla extract, shredded coconut, and chopped pecans.

Once the cakes are done, remove them from the oven and allow them to cool in the pans for a few minutes. Then, transfer them to a wire rack to cool completely.

Chocolate Buttercream frosting:
Ingredients:

1 cup (226g) unsalted butter, softened

21/2 cups (313g) powdered sugar

1/2 cup (50g) unsweetened cocoa powder

3tbsp (45ml) evaporated milk (or normal milk)

1 teaspoon vanilla extract

A pinch of salt

Instructions:

In a large mixing bowl, beat the softened butter until it's creamy and smooth.

Sift the powdered sugar and cocoa powder into the bowl to ensure there are no lumps. Mix on low speed to combine with the butter.

Add the milk, vanilla extract, and a pinch of salt. Beat on low speed initially to avoid powdered sugar flying out of the bowl, then increase the speed to medium-high. Beat until the frosting is smooth and fluffy. If it's too thick, you can add a little more milk. If it's too thin, add more powdered sugar.

Once you achieve the desired consistency and flavor, your chocolate buttercream frosting is ready to use. Spread it over your German chocolate cake once the cake has cooled completely.

Once the cakes are completely cool, spread the coconut pecan filling  over one of the cakes, then place the second cake on top, and frost the top and sides of the entire cake.
